Senior Data Engineer

Salla is an e-commerce platform company specializing in high-traffic, data-intensive solutions.
Makkah Saudi Arabia
Data
Senior Software Engineer
Hybrid
5+ years of experience
E-Commerce

Description For Senior Data Engineer

Salla is seeking a Senior Data Engineer to join their Product Development team in a hybrid work environment. This role focuses on building scalable real-time analytics solutions with expertise in ClickHouse and streaming data. The ideal candidate will be responsible for designing and optimizing data pipelines and analytics infrastructure that drive business growth and enhance customer experience. The position requires strong technical skills in data engineering, with emphasis on real-time processing, cloud platforms, and distributed systems. The role offers an opportunity to work with cutting-edge technologies while mentoring junior engineers and contributing to the team's continuous improvement. With a focus on e-commerce and high-traffic data environments, this position combines technical expertise with collaborative teamwork to deliver impactful solutions for the organization.

Last updated 2 months ago

Responsibilities For Senior Data Engineer

  • Design, implement, maintain and document highly scalable data pipelines for real-time and batch processing
  • Build and optimize data systems to support accurate, low-latency analytics and reporting use cases
  • Develop and maintain solutions for streaming and serverless data processing
  • Collaborate with cross-functional teams to implement and support end-to-end analytics workflows
  • Ensure data quality, reliability, and performance across the platform
  • Monitor, troubleshoot, and optimize data infrastructure to maintain high availability
  • Mentor junior engineers and contribute to the continuous improvement of engineering practices

Requirements For Senior Data Engineer

Python
Java
Kafka
Kubernetes
  • 5+ years of experience in data engineering or related fields
  • Strong expertise in ClickHouse: experience in designing schemas and jobs, optimizing data ingestion as well as queries, managing clusters
  • Proven experience in real-time data processing and enrichment using tools like Apache Kafka, Apache Flink, Apache Spark Streaming, Serverless technologies
  • Deep understanding of Distributed systems architecture and design, with a focus on scalability and resilience
  • Proficiency in programming languages like Python, or Java
  • Hands-on experience with cloud platforms (AWS, GCP, or Azure)
  • Familiarity with containerization and orchestration tools such as Docker and Kubernetes
  • Strong problem-solving skills and ability to work in a fast-paced environment
  • Excellent communication and collaboration skills

Interested in this job?

Jobs Related To Salla Senior Data Engineer

Senior Data Scientist, YouTube Premium

Senior Data Scientist position at YouTube Premium focusing on analytics, modeling, and data-driven product strategy, offering competitive compensation and benefits.

Senior Data Scientist, Research, Ads Metrics

Senior Data Scientist position at Google focusing on ads metrics research, offering competitive salary and opportunity to shape advertising products through data-driven decisions.

Senior Data Scientist, Research

Senior Data Scientist position at Google, working on product analytics and development using Python and SQL, with 5+ years of experience required.

Senior Data Scientist, Search (Real World Journeys)

Senior Data Scientist position at Google, focusing on Search analytics and Real World Journeys, requiring expertise in data analysis, programming, and fluency in English and Portuguese.

Customer Engineer, Data Analytics, Google Cloud

Senior Data Engineer role at Google Cloud focusing on data analytics and customer engineering, offering competitive compensation and benefits.